「走近彭修文」 —— 音樂會前導賞講座
Pre-Concert Talk: Getting to Know Peng Xiuwen
想知道《豐收鑼鼓》的熱鬧歡騰是怎麼用樂器「敲」出來的?《月兒高》的詩意朦朧又如何透過樂團層層鋪展?
Ever wondered how the festive energy of Harvest Drums is “drummed up” by the orchestra? Or how the poetic beauty of The Rising Moon unfolds layer by layer through the ensemble?
在音樂會正式登場之前,我們誠摯邀請您參加一場輕鬆而深入的會前講座。這不僅是一場曲目導聆,更是一次與指揮、樂友近距離交流的難得機會。
Before the main concert, we warmly invite you to join us for a relaxed and insightful pre-concert talk. This is not just a guided listening session, but also a rare opportunity to connect up close with our conductor and fellow music lovers.
本次講座將由庇詩中樂團音樂總監 張進老師 親自引領,與大家一同聊聊這場紀念彭修文大師95歲冥誕音樂會中的每一首作品。從《八仙拜壽》的吹打熱鬧,到《流水操》的氣勢奔騰;從青年團演繹的《春江花月夜》,到女高音與樂隊交織的《陽關三叠》——張老師將以深入淺出的方式,帶您聽懂樂曲中的故事、情感與匠心。
The talk will be led by Jin Zhang, Music Director of the BC Chinese Orchestra. Together, we will explore each piece in this concert commemorating the 95th anniversary of the birth of the great Chinese national orchestra master, Peng Xiuwen. From the lively winds and percussion of Eight Immortals Celebrating Longevity to the sweeping grandeur of Rowing on the River; from the BC Youth Chinese Orchestra’s rendition of the timeless Spring River Moonlit Night to the poignant interplay of soprano and orchestra in Three Variations on Yangguan Pass — Jin will guide you through the stories, emotions, and artistry behind the music in an engaging and accessible way.
無論您是資深樂迷,還是剛開始接觸中樂,都歡迎帶著好奇與耳朵一起來,聽聽音樂背後的那些事,也與我們聊聊您的感受。
Whether you are a long-time enthusiast or new to Chinese music, feel free to bring your curiosity and an open ear. Come listen, share your thoughts, and be part of the conversation.
